Oprah Drops Show Topic On Banning City Cyclists

                          CHICAGO, IL (BR&IN)-TV talk show host Oprah
Winfrey canned
                          the idea to do a show on outlawing cyclists =
from
city streets. The idea
                          was posted last week on her web site,
www.oprah.com, in a section
                          where she lists possible upcoming show topics =
and
solicits opinions.

                          Word went out across the bike industry =
immediately
about the show.
                          People were urged to write and protest the =
idea.
The topic called for
                          discussing possible laws to limit where a =
person
can ride a bike in a city.
                          The web site asked for stories about people
involved in accidents
                          "because of a careless bike rider on a city
street."

                          On Thursday, the topic showed up in the =
"killed"
show topics folder on
                          the web site. No reason was given for =
abandoning
the idea. =A9Bicycle
                          Retailer & Industry News
